Greenetrack charities distribute $67, 500 to local non-profit groups

The non-profit charities operating electronic bingo at Greenetrack in Eutaw, AL, E-911 Communication Services, the Greene County Volunteer Fire Fighters Association, and Woman to Woman, Inc., provided charitable contributions, for the month of June, to a variety of local organizations, all benefitting Greene County residents.According to Luther Winn, Greenetrack CEO, “By giving to the organizations […]
